Unveiling the DNA Revolution: How Haelixa Fights Counterfeit Watches (2026)

The world of luxury goods, especially in the watch and jewelry industry, is facing a growing challenge: counterfeiting. With an estimated annual loss of $250 billion to the global luxury sector, brands are taking proactive measures to protect their products and consumers. Enter Haelixa, a Swiss company with a unique approach to combating this issue.

Unveiling Haelixa's DNA-Based Solution

Haelixa's innovative technology utilizes DNA markers to provide forensic proof of authenticity. This patented technology, developed in 2016, initially focused on raw materials like textiles, precious metals, and gemstones. By applying DNA-based nanoparticles directly at the source, such as mines or refineries, Haelixa ensures traceability throughout the supply chain.

However, their approach doesn't stop there. Haelixa also offers a forensic-level solution for finished goods. This version of their technology, launched in 2025, aims to authenticate luxury goods against counterfeiting. With a focus on the Swiss watch and jewelry industry, Haelixa's Director of Anti-Counterfeiting and Brand Protection, Klemens Link, emphasizes the sophistication of modern counterfeiters.

The Science Behind Haelixa's DNA Markers

Haelixa's DNA markers are applied through a simple process of submersion in a carrier liquid, ensuring no residue remains. The real magic lies in their patented encapsulation method, which protects the DNA strands from decay over time. This technology has been rigorously tested and proven effective, even under simulated aging conditions.

The testing process is equally straightforward, utilizing rapid PCR tests similar to those we've become familiar with during the COVID-19 pandemic. Within 30 minutes, a simple swab and a specialized testing machine can provide authentication results.

A Holistic Approach to Brand Protection

Haelixa's business model empowers brands to take control of their product authentication. While they work closely with long-term clients to develop unique DNA sequences, their ultimate goal is to equip brands with the tools to track and authenticate their products independently. This means brands can install verification machines in their own facilities, ensuring rapid and efficient authentication processes.

Currently, Haelixa serves B2B clients, including brand protection departments, secondary market platforms, and law enforcement agencies. However, they envision a future where consumers can directly access their technology to safeguard their personal collections.
